Security Hood Switch Circuit Troubleshooting

WARNING: This page does not describe the selected car, but rather 6 other vehicles, including the 2014 Honda Ridgeline, 2013 Honda Ridgeline, 2012 Honda Ridgeline, 2011 Honda Ridgeline, and 2010 Honda Ridgeline. However, it is still accessible from the selected car via links, so may be relevant.
  1. Turn the ignition switch to ON (II).
  2. With the hood closed, select SECURITY with the HDS, and enter the DATA LIST.
  3. Check the ON/OFF information of the SECURITY HOOD SWITCH in the DATA LIST.

    Is information indicator ON? 

    YES  -Go to step 4.

    NO  -Go to step  8.

  4. Disconnect the security hood switch 2P connector.
  5. Check the ON/OFF information of the SECURITY HOOD SWITCH in the DATA LIST.

    Is information indicator OFF? 

    YES  -Faulty security hood switch; replace the hood latch (see HOOD LATCH REPLACEMENT ).

    NO  -Go to step 6.

  6. Disconnect under-hood fuse/relay box connector H (18P).
  7. Check for continuity between under-hood fuse/relay box connector H (18P) terminal No. 2 and body ground.
    Fig 1: Checking For Continuity Between Under-Hood Fuse/Relay Box Connector H (18P) Terminal No. 2 And Body Ground
    G00509338Courtesy of AMERICAN HONDA MOTOR CO., INC.

    Is there continuity? 

    YES  -Repair a short to ground in the wire.

    NO  -Faulty relay control module; replace the under-hood fuse/relay box (see REMOVAL AND INSTALLATION ).

  8. Disconnect the security hood switch 2P connector.
  9. Connect security hood switch 2P connector terminal No. 2 and body ground with a jumper wire.
    Fig 2: Connecting Security Hood Switch 2P Connector Terminal No. 2 And Body Ground With A Jumper Wire
    G00509339Courtesy of AMERICAN HONDA MOTOR CO., INC.
  10. Check the ON/OFF information of the SECURITY HOOD SWITCH in the DATA LIST.

    Is information indicator ON? 

    YES  -Go to step 11.

    NO  -Go to step  12.

  11. Check for continuity between security hood switch 2P connector terminal No. 1 and body ground.
    Fig 3: Checking For Continuity Between Security Hood Switch 2P Connector Terminal No. 1 And Body Ground
    G00509340Courtesy of AMERICAN HONDA MOTOR CO., INC.

    Is there continuity? 

    YES  -Faulty security hood switch; replace the hood latch (see HOOD LATCH REPLACEMENT ).

    NO  -Repair an open or high resistance in the ground wire or poor ground (G201).

  12. Connect under-hood fuse/relay box connector H (18P) terminal No. 2 and body ground with a jumper wire.
    Fig 4: Connecting Under-Hood Fuse/Relay Box Connector H (18P) Terminal No. 2 And Body Ground With A Jumper Wire
    G00509341Courtesy of AMERICAN HONDA MOTOR CO., INC.
  13. Check the ON/OFF information of the SECURITY HOOD SWITCH in the DATA LIST.

    Is information indicator ON? 

    YES  -Repair an open or high resistance in the wire.

    NO  -Faulty relay control module; replace the under-hood fuse/relay box (see REMOVAL AND INSTALLATION ).
